## Indicated points (no sourced protocol)

These points list the symptom among their indications. An indication list is a reference index, not a prescription.

| Point | Name | Meridian | Location |
|---|---|---|---|
| ST37 | Upper Great Hollow | Stomach Meridian | 6 thumb widths below ST35, 1 finger breadth (middle finger) from anterior border of the tibia. |
| BL13 | Lung Shu Point | Bladder Meridian | 1.5 thumb widths lateral to the GV12 at the level of the lower border of the spinous process of the 3rd thoracic vertebra. |
| BL42 | Door Of The Corporeal Soul | Bladder Meridian | 3 thumb widths lateral to the du mai at the level of the lower border of the spinous process of the 3rd thoracic vertebra on the spinal border of the scapula. |
| BL43 | Vital Region Shu Point | Bladder Meridian | 3 thumb widths lateral to the du mai at the level of the lower border of the spinous process of the 4th thoracic vertebra on the spinal border of the scapula. |
| LV03 | Great Surge | Liver Meridian | On the dorsum of the foot in the depression the distal to the junction of the 1st and 2nd metatarsal bones. |
| CV04 | Original Qi Gate | Conception Vessel | On the anterior midline 3 thumb widths below umbilicus. |
| GV10 | Spirit Tower | Governing Vessel | Below spinous process of the 6th thoracic vertebra. |
| GV11 | Spirit Path | Governing Vessel | Below spinous process of the 5th thoracic vertebra. |
| GV22 | Fontanelle Meeting | Governing Vessel | 2 thumb widths posterior to the midpoint of the anterior hairline 3 thumb widths anterior to the GV20. |
| XB07 | Waist Eyes | Extra Points: Back | In the depression the approximately 3.5 thumb widths lateral to the lower border of the l4 (yaoyangguan du-3) lumbar eyes refers to the visible hollows found in the many people, just over one handbreadth either side of the spine, below the level of the iliac crest. |
| XH15 | Hundred Taxations | Extra Points: Head | At the back of the neck, 2 thumb widths superior to the dazhui du-14, 1 thumb width lateral to the midline. |
